Common use of Identifier Clause in Contracts

Identifier. Neither you nor your administrator nor any additional user may allow anyone else to have any identifier unless you authorize him or her to use Online Banking on your behalf. You, your administrator and each additional user must keep each identifier in a secure location separate from any equipment (for example, a computer or mobile banking device) or software you use or your administrator or any additional user uses in connection with Online Banking. For reasons of security, we or any agent of ours may render any identifier ineffective. WE WILL NOT BE LIABLE FOR DAMAGES YOU SUFFER AS A RESULT OF YOU, YOUR ADMINISTRATOR OR ANY ADDITIONAL USER ALLOWING ANYONE ELSE (FOR EXAMPLE, A PARTY THAT AGGREGATES ACCOUNT INFORMATION OR CONTENT OF WEBSITES) TO HAVE ANY IDENTIFIER.
